Welcome to Pompano Beach

Pompano Beach was incorporated in 1908 and became known for its deep-sea fishing and offshore reefs. A recent beach renourishment project has created wide, elegant beaches and a new beachfront promenade stretching over two miles.
 
Ideal for both retirees and families, Pompano’s crime rate is below the county average. The city offers top public schools, multiple marinas, and a flourishing arts district making it a hidden gem on the Gold Coast.
